/**
 * The nsIWebPageDescriptor interface allows content being displayed in one
 * window to be loaded into another window without refetching it from the
 * network.
 *
 * @status UNDER_REVIEW
 */
class NS_NO_VTABLE NS_SCRIPTABLE nsIWebPageDescriptor : public nsISupports {
 public: 

  NS_DECLARE_STATIC_IID_ACCESSOR(NS_IWEBPAGEDESCRIPTOR_IID)

  enum { DISPLAY_AS_SOURCE = 1U };

  enum { DISPLAY_NORMAL = 2U };

  /**
  * Tells the object to load the page specified by the page descriptor
  *
  * @return NS_OK            - 
  *         NS_ERROR_FAILURE - 
  */
  /* void loadPage (in nsISupports aPageDescriptor, in unsigned long aDisplayType); */
  NS_SCRIPTABLE NS_IMETHOD LoadPage(nsISupports *aPageDescriptor, PRUint32 aDisplayType) = 0;

  /**
  * Retrieves the page descriptor for the curent document.
  */
  /* readonly attribute nsISupports currentDescriptor; */
  NS_SCRIPTABLE NS_IMETHOD GetCurrentDescriptor(nsISupports * *aCurrentDescriptor) = 0;

};
